Domaine de la Janasse delivers a textbook Châteauneuf-du-Pape with this expertly crafted blend. Dominated by 65% Grenache, balanced with Syrah, Mourvèdre, and Cinsault, it’s sourced from diverse terroirs, including a touch of the legendary Le Crau.

Hand-harvested and vinified with care (20% whole cluster), this wine is aged in a mix of foudre and French oak barrels, adding depth and elegance. Expect layers of ripe raspberry, black cherry, and plum, lifted by hints of garrigue, licorice, and spice, with a long, polished finish.

Decanter

Expressive on the nose, with good ripeness to the damson and juniper fruit. It has plenty of presence and grip, and quite precise acidity which helps to lengthen the palate. Savoury, well balanced. Partially destemmed, fermented in concrete, aged mostly in foudres and some old barriques.

Wine Spectator

Tasty and ripe, with an open profile marked by sappy red cherry, anise and generous floral perfume. Meaty and fleshy on the vanilla-kissed palate, with crushed iron bringing balance, while dried rosemary, charred mesquite and herbal lift emerge. There's a lot to like about this alluring red, which is drinking beautifully now (and will age well, too). Grenache, Syrah, Mourvèdre and Cinsault. Drink now through 2032
